What are the crucial regulatory requirements for home healthcare providers in the UK?
Home healthcare providers operating within the UK must adhere to specific regulations to ensure safe and ethical practices. Compliance with CQC standards and local health authority guidelines is imperative for maintaining high-quality care. Essential compliance steps include:
- Registering with the Care Quality Commission (CQC)
- Conducting regular staff training alongside comprehensive background checks
- Implementing robust safeguarding policies to protect vulnerable individuals
- Maintaining accurate and up-to-date patient records to guarantee continuity of care
- Ensuring transparent billing practices that cultivate trust and clarity with clients
Navigating these regulatory frameworks is crucial for safeguarding your marketing efforts and upholding industry standards, which can have a significant impact on your reputation and operational success in the ever-evolving home healthcare market.

What does home healthcare encompass?
Home healthcare refers to a variety of medical and non-medical services delivered in a patient’s home, aimed at promoting health, independence, and an enhanced quality of life for individuals receiving care.
How should I choose the most suitable home healthcare provider?
When selecting a home healthcare provider, consider important factors such as accreditation, the range of services offered, client reviews, and the qualifications of staff members to ensure high-quality care that meets individual needs.
What services are typically included in home healthcare packages?
Services may encompass personal care, skilled nursing, physical therapy, and companionship, all tailored to effectively meet individual patient needs and preferences for a holistic approach to care.
